Left my 11 month old husky/aussie there for 5 days this past week. She had never been to a kennel boarder before and I was quite worried. Lynne seems very knowledgeable and kind. She explained that Sadie would be well taken care of and able to play with other dogs (if compatible). I toured the property to see all the kennels (there are 2 clusters of kennel/runs both below their house and behind). I much prefer the lower kennels and will request she stay there. I was allowed to leave her a dog bed from home, some of her toys, and a bone to help her pass the time when she is inside her kennel. It was comforting that Lynne gave me her cell # to text her to check in as often as I wanted. I called after the first night to check in and was told Sadie was doing wonderfully. She had made friends with another dog her size and age (just under under 1 yr) who was also there for the week. I immediately felt relived to hear she was doing so well and had a new friend. When I picked her up, she was outside in the play area of the kennel with her new buddy, happy as could be. Lynne was there in the kennel area (down at the bottom of her driveway) as I pulled up. I was advised from the start that if they are not at the kennel when I arrive, I was to go to the main house and knock on the door. Clearly they can't be with every dog, every minute of the day. The dog areas are clean and well maintained, I didn't see any p*** on the ground in the run upon arrival. They are a little muddy from them hosing out the kennels so often. Overall I was pleased with her stay. I made another reservation for Thanksgiving week, which will be a bit longer of a stay - so I will be back to update my review after her next visit.
